While verifying the fix for unstable secondary sorting in the Lumina report builder, the nightly regression suite began failing at setup. Root cause: the service credential used to pull fixture datasets from the internal DataVault API expired last week, so every sort-stability case aborts before assertions run. No production impact; the builder itself is unaffected. A replacement credential was issued with read-only scope, ninety-day expiry. The suite should be reconfigured to authenticate with the key below.

gateway credential: kto7_GoY89Me

## EXIF Scrubbing — Env Vars

PixelRinse strips EXIF data from every upload before it hits the CDN. Most settings live in `scrub.yaml`, but the scrubber worker needs its signing credential from the environment so we never commit it. Future maintainers: rotate this quarterly, and don't reuse the staging one. Add the following line to your `.env` to authorize the scrub worker.

vault entry, yahif-yajep: COURIER_KEY29=b802bdf8034096b65a51c6ba5abe2

Ticket KSK-412: Config drift on Brightfoyer kiosk watchdog. Three lobby units in the Marlowe deployment are running a stale watchdog restart interval, likely from a manual hotfix in June that never landed in the provisioning repo. Symptom: kiosks hang up to nine minutes before recovery. Fix is to re-sync from the canonical template. For reference, the intended watchdog configuration is as follows.

service settings:
[casax]
port = 6379
team = rusir
host = casax.zemvarhq.corp
region = outer-4
access_code = ac_9808ce
timeout_ms = 1500